How it works
Sell via Retail with AirBox
- Step 1
Fit assessment
Use the payout calculator to model retail margins yourself, then shortlist the store formats that match your product and price point.
- Step 2
Listing and placement
We handle store onboarding, barcodes, local labelling requirements and negotiate shelf placement on your behalf.
- Step 3
Advertise in-store
Run retail activations through part-time hires for tastings, flyers, offline bundling and other point-of-sale campaigns.
- Step 4
Stock and replenish
Your stock sits in our warehouse and moves to stores as sell-through data comes in, preventing dead inventory sitting in the wrong location.

Questions brands ask
Do I need a local entity to sell in stores?
No. AirBox can act as your Merchant on Record so invoicing, compliance and payments run through a local entity while the brand stays yours.
What happens to stock that doesn't move?
Our agents reallocate slow-moving stock to higher-velocity locations or other channels instead of leaving it on a shelf.
How fast can we be live?
Most brands start moving into stores within weeks of stock landing in our facility, depending on category and labelling requirements.
